The Ermaksan Micro-Bend 25 Compact Press Brake is a versatile machine designed for forming sheet metal bends with a bend length capacity of up to 12 feet. It is suitable for high tonnage applications and can work with materials such as mild steel, stainless steel, and aluminum. This press brake is ideal for producing brackets, panels, and enclosures, making it a valuable asset for industries like automotive, construction, and HVAC.

What to Inspect Before You Buy

  • Check the maximum bend length to ensure it meets your project requirements.
  • Verify the tonnage capacity to ensure it can handle your material thickness and type.
  • Inspect the compatibility with the materials you plan to work with, such as aluminum or stainless steel.
  • Evaluate the machine’s condition, especially if purchasing a used model.
  • Review the maintenance records for any signs of frequent repairs or issues.
  • Test the machine’s precision and accuracy in bending operations.
  • Assess the control system for user-friendliness and advanced features.
  • Ensure availability of technical support and service from the manufacturer or supplier.
  • Check for any included accessories or tooling that may add value.
  • Consider the overall footprint to ensure it fits within your facility’s space constraints.
